Melinda Ferguson’s new book, When Love Kills: The Tragic Tale of AKA and Anele, goes on sale next week.
Kiernan Forbes, widely known as the rapper AKA, was fatally shot outside a restaurant in Durban in February 2023. His close friend, the chef and entrepreneur Tebello “Tibz” Motsoane, was also killed in the attack.
Anele Tembe was the young woman who tragically fell to her death from the 10th floor of the Pepperclub Hotel on Loop Street in Cape Town in April 2021, where she was staying with her fiancé, AKA.
The book’s release was initially revealed on social media on the third anniversary of Anele’s death.
“I have never worked harder on a book,” Ferguson wrote on Facebook.
“I have never been more freaked out by a story. I have never kept a secret like I have this one, but the news [of the book’s release] has just been leaked on social media.
“So here it is from the fire horse’s mouth. It’s been a real journey to get this out. It nearly killed my own relationship. It’s a story that broke my heart.”
